Seven Seas Voyager Enrichment
Featured Luminary: Mark Conroy
Featured Luminary: Mark Conroy

Join Regent Seven Seas Cruises' President Mark Conroy as he hosts this voyage. The longest-standing president of any cruise line, having been with the line since its inception in 1992, Mark will be hosting cocktail receptions where all guests are welcome, as well as Town Hall meetings where he and a panel of officers will answer guests' questions about the ship or cruise line.

Le Cordon Bleu Workshop
Le Cordon Bleu Workshop

Since its inception in Paris in 1895, Le Cordon Bleu has been dedicated to preserving and passing on the mastery and appreciation of the culinary arts. Not only have Regent Seven Seas Cruises and Le Cordon Bleu partnered to offer Signatures, the first and only permanent Le Cordon Bleu restaurants at sea, but they have also created Le Cordon Bleu Workshops. During the workshops, Le Cordon Bleu chefs will provide an introduction to the art of French cooking. This exclusive, hands-on experience is limited in numbers. Guests will take part in three intensive two-hour workshops during the voyage. The workshops include fascinating cooking demonstrations detailing the preparation and presentation of French cuisine, and updated for contemporary tastes. Guests will also discover the secrets and techniques of world-renowned chefs, and participate in preparing selections from the ship's own Le Cordon Bleu menus. A dinner with the Le Cordon Bleu Chef will be organized during the voyage, and a graduation ceremony and dinner will take in Signatures Restaurant. Graduates will receive their own chef's apron and hat, a tea towel, a special Le Cordon Bleu cookbook of classic recipes, and a certificate of participation. Program Fare: $499 per person
